Course details

Here are the essential units for a Global Certificate Course in Cross-Cultural HR Management in China:


◦ Understanding Chinese Culture: Traditions, Values, and Beliefs

◦ HR Management in China: Legal and Compliance Considerations

◦ Cross-Cultural Communication in the Chinese Workplace

◦ Recruitment and Selection in China: Best Practices

◦ Performance Management and Employee Development in China

◦ Compensation and Benefits in China: Designing Competitive Packages

◦ Employee Engagement and Retention in China: Strategies and Tactics

◦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ion in the Chinese Workplace

◦ Navigating Chinese Labor Laws and Regulations

◦ Case Studies: Cross-Cultural HR Management in Chinese Companies
